Benchmark or risk-level descriptions. DIBELS 8th Edition. Provides four levels to describe student performance: Above Benchmark: 65th-99th percentile. At Benchmark: 55th-64th percentile. Below Benchmark: 30th-54th percentile*. Well Below Benchmark: below 30th percentile*.DIBELS 8th Edition. CTL-DIBELS 8. th. Edition Threshold Levels 202. 1. -202. 2. Scores in the table are the minimum values needed for a student to be considered "Progressing" toward future reading success. Scores below these numbers indicate a student who is "At Risk" for future reading difficulty. A complete list of composite scores can be found at. DIBELS ® (Dynamic Indicators of Basic Early Literacy Skills) is a set of procedures and measures for assessing the acquisition of literacy skills. The LSAT percentile score is the percent of test takers that scored lower than you on the LSAT over the past 3 years. The conversion from scaled score to percentile score tends to be pretty stable with only a few differences over time. LSAT Percentiles Score Chart.
